Verdict

Fayetteville, AR offers better overall compensation for veterinarians, winning 3 out of 4 metrics compared to Conway.

The salary gap between Conway and Fayetteville is $10,450 (9.42%). Fayetteville's median is -11.65% compared to the US national median of $137,334.

Cost-of-Living Adjusted Comparison

After cost-of-living adjustment, Fayetteville ($132,827 effective) pays 4.09% more than Conway ($127,608 effective).

Methodology & Data Source

All salary figures are 2026 projections based on BLS OEWS May 2025 data. A 5.56% CAGR (derived from 6-year national BLS trends) was applied to estimate current compensation. Cost-of-living adjustments use BEA Regional Price Parity data. Actual salaries vary by employer, certifications, and experience.
